Laminate Floor Installation in Arvada, CO
Laminate floor installation services involve placing durable, attractive laminate flooring over existing surfaces in resid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and basements. Homeowners typically want to understand the different styles, finishes, and durability options available, as well as the preparation required for a smooth installation process. Proper installation ensures the flooring's longevity and appearance, making it an important step in enhancing the overall look and value of a property.
Before requesting laminate floor installation, property owners should consider factors such as the subfloor condition, moisture levels, and the type of laminate suitable for their space. It's also helpful to clarify the scope of the project, including whether existing flooring needs removal and if any subfloor repairs are necessary. Understanding these details can help ensure the installation process proceeds efficiently and results in a durable, visually appealing floor that meets the specific needs of the home.

Laminate Floor Installation Questions
What types of laminate flooring are available for installation? There are various styles and finishes to choose from, including wood-look, stone-look, and textured surfaces suitable for different interior designs.
Is laminate flooring su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, laminate flooring is durable and resistant to scratches and wear, making it ideal for busy spaces like hallways and living rooms.
What preparations are needed before installing laminate flooring?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per installation and long-lasting performance.
Can laminate flooring be installed over existing floors? In many cases, laminate can be installed over existing flooring if the surface is flat and stable, but some situations may require removal of previous materials.
